Oscar SEO AI
Oscar SEO AI

Intégration Shopify

Connectez Oscar à votre boutique Shopify pour qu'il publie automatiquement des articles de blog optimisés SEO.

⚠️ Très important avant de commencer

Effectuez toutes les opérations dans le même navigateur. C'est ce qui permet à Shopify et à Oscar de communiquer correctement entre eux. Gardez la même fenêtre du début à la fin du processus.
S

Compatibilité

Shopify Basic, Shopify, Advanced Shopify, Shopify Plus

Dans ce tutoriel, nous allons voir :

  • Comment récupérer le nom de votre boutique Shopify
  • Comment créer une application dans le dashboard développeur Shopify
  • Comment récupérer votre Client ID et votre Client Secret
  • Comment connecter votre boutique à Oscar
  • Comment connecter Google Search Console pour suivre vos performances SEO

Étape 1 : Se connecter à Shopify et récupérer le nom de la boutique

1

Connectez-vous à votre boutique Shopify

Dans votre navigateur, ouvrez la page d'administration de Shopify :

https://admin.shopify.com/store/votre-boutique
Page d'administration Shopify

Page d'administration Shopify

2

Identifiez le nom de votre boutique

L'adresse de votre admin contient le nom de votre boutique. Par exemple :

https://admin.shopify.com/store/6b6fbb-01

La partie après /store/ correspond au nom de la boutique, ici : 6b6fbb-01

📋 Copiez ce nom

Notez-le quelque part (bloc-notes ou document). Nous en aurons besoin plus tard dans Oscar, dans le champ "site web".

Étape 2 : Accéder au dashboard développeur et créer l'application

1

Accédez aux paramètres

Dans votre admin Shopify, en bas à gauche, cliquez sur Paramètres.

2

Allez dans Applications et canaux de vente

Dans les paramètres, cliquez sur Applications et canaux de vente.

En haut de cette page, vous verrez un lien « Développer des applications ». Cliquez dessus.

Section Applications et canaux de vente

Section Applications et canaux de vente

3

Accédez au Dev Dashboard

Cliquez sur « Accéder au dev dashboard » ou équivalent.

Confirmation des risques

Shopify peut vous demander de confirmer que vous comprenez les risques liés aux applications personnalisées. Acceptez les conditions pour continuer.
4

Créez une nouvelle application

Dans le dashboard développeur, cliquez sur « Create app » ou « Créer une application ».

Donnez un nom à l'application, par exemple :

Oscar AI

Puis cliquez sur « Create » pour valider la création.

Formulaire de création d'application

Formulaire de création d'application

Étape 3 : Configurer l'application (App URL, scopes et redirect URL)

Vous êtes maintenant dans la configuration de l'application que vous venez de créer.

1

Renseignez l'App URL

Dans la partie App URL, renseignez l'URL suivante :

https://oscar-ia-backend-live.onrender.com/api/shopify/oauth/callback

C'est l'adresse de la plateforme Oscar qui sera utilisée comme base pour l'intégration.

2

Configurez les permissions (scopes)

Descendez jusqu'à la rubrique Access ou Access scopes.

Cliquez sur « Select scopes » ou « Configurer les permissions ».

Scopes à sélectionner :

Dans la barre de recherche, tapez "content" et cochez :

  • read_content
  • write_content

Puis tapez "files" et cochez :

  • read_files
  • write_files

Une fois ces quatre scopes sélectionnés, cliquez sur « Save ».

Sélection des permissions de l'application

Sélection des permissions de l'application

Pourquoi ces permissions ?

Ces permissions permettent à Oscar de créer et de gérer le contenu de blog ainsi que les fichiers (images) associés sur votre boutique Shopify.
3

Ajoutez l'URL de redirection

Juste en dessous, trouvez la section Redirect URLs ou « URL de redirection ».

Ajoutez l'URL suivante :

https://oscar-ia-backend-live.onrender.com/api/shopify/oauth/callback

Puis validez en cliquant sur « Save », « Enregistrer » ou « Release ».

Cette URL est indispensable pour que Shopify puisse renvoyer correctement l'autorisation vers Oscar.

Étape 4 : Récupérer le Client ID et le Client Secret

1

Accédez aux paramètres de l'application

Toujours dans la configuration de votre application, ouvrez le menu de gauche et allez dans Settings ou « Paramètres de l'application ».

2

Copiez le Client ID et le Client Secret

Vous y trouverez deux informations essentielles :

Client ID (ou API key)

Identifiant unique de votre application

Client Secret (clé secrète)

Clé confidentielle à ne jamais partager

Récupération du Client ID et Client Secret

Récupération du Client ID et Client Secret

Conservez ces informations

Copiez ces deux valeurs et conservez-les dans un endroit sûr. Nous allons les coller ensuite dans Oscar.

📋 À ce stade, vous devez avoir :

  • Le nom de la boutique (ex: 6b6fbb-01)
  • Le Client ID
  • Le Client Secret

Étape 5 : Se connecter à la plateforme Oscar

Rappel important

Restez bien dans le même navigateur que celui utilisé pour Shopify.
1

Accédez à la plateforme Oscar

Ouvrez l'e-mail que vous avez reçu lors de votre inscription, ou rendez-vous directement sur :

https://www.app.oscar-seo.ai →
2

Connectez-vous ou créez votre mot de passe

Entrez votre adresse e-mail.

Si vous ne vous êtes jamais connecté, cliquez sur « Mot de passe oublié » pour définir votre mot de passe, puis connectez-vous.

Page de connexion Oscar

Page de connexion Oscar

Étape 6 : Configurer votre entreprise dans Oscar

Configuration unique

La configuration est unique : une fois validée, vous ne pouvez plus la modifier vous-même. Prenez le temps de bien remplir tous les champs.
1

Remplissez les informations de base

Indiquez :

  • Le nom de votre entreprise
  • Votre secteur d'activité
  • Votre zone géographique
  • Vos produits ou services principaux
  • Le type de clients que vous ciblez
Formulaire de configuration de l'entreprise

Formulaire de configuration de l'entreprise

2

Ajoutez les « Informations importantes »

C'est ici qu'Oscar va chercher vos consignes globales. Vous pouvez indiquer :

  • Si vous faites des livraisons ou des services à domicile
  • Vos conditions particulières (délais, frais, zones desservies)
  • Des informations tarifaires importantes
  • Le ton de rédaction souhaité : « ton jovial, accessible, mais style professionnel et rassurant »

Ces informations s'appliquent à tous les articles que produira Oscar.

3

Validez la configuration

Une fois l'ensemble des champs renseignés, validez la configuration de votre entreprise.

Étape 7 : Connecter Oscar à Shopify

1

Accédez au provider Shopify

Dans la plateforme Oscar, allez dans l'onglet « Provider » ou « Fournisseur » et choisissez Shopify.

Onglet Provider - Shopify

Onglet Provider - Shopify

2

Remplissez les trois champs

Vous voyez un formulaire avec trois champs à remplir :

1. Site web

⚠️ Ce n'est pas l'URL classique, mais le nom de votre boutique :

6b6fbb-01

C'est la partie après /store/ dans l'URL de votre admin Shopify.

2. Client ID

Collez le Client ID copié depuis le dashboard développeur Shopify.

3. Client Secret

Collez le Client Secret copié depuis les paramètres de l'application Shopify.

3

Cliquez sur Connecter

Vérifiez que les trois champs sont correctement remplis, puis cliquez sur « Connecter ».

Une fenêtre modale apparaît avec deux options :

  • Cliquer sur « Installer sur Shopify »
  • Ou copier le lien fourni et le coller dans un nouvel onglet du même navigateur
4

Installez l'application dans Shopify

Vous êtes redirigé vers votre boutique Shopify.

Shopify vous demande de confirmer l'installation. Vérifiez que les permissions affichées correspondent aux scopes configurés (content, files), puis cliquez sur « Installer » ou « Install app ».

Confirmation d'installation dans Shopify

Confirmation d'installation dans Shopify

Connexion établie !

Une fois l'application installée, la connexion entre Shopify et Oscar est en place. Revenez sur la plateforme Oscar.

Étape 8 : Nommer votre Oscar et définir le mode de publication

1

Accédez à l'onglet Oscar AI

Dans Oscar, allez dans l'onglet « Oscar AI ».

2

Configurez votre Oscar

Vous pouvez :

  • Donner un nom à votre Oscar, par exemple : « Oscar – Boutique Shopify »
  • Choisir le mode de publication :

Publication automatique

Les articles seront directement visibles sur votre blog Shopify.

Mode brouillon

Vous pourrez relire et valider manuellement avant publication.

3

Validez vos réglages

Enregistrez votre configuration.

Étape 9 : Rythme de publication et apparition des articles

Oscar va commencer à rédiger et publier des articles sur votre boutique, selon le rythme de publication de votre pack : Starter, Boost ou Scale.

⏱️ Délai d'apparition

Le premier article peut mettre entre 2 heures et 48 heures à apparaître, en fonction du rythme choisi.

1

Retrouvez vos articles dans Shopify

Les articles générés par Oscar apparaissent dans votre interface Shopify, dans :

Contenu → Articles de blog
Les articles générés par Oscar dans Shopify

Les articles générés par Oscar dans Shopify

2

Consultez et personnalisez si besoin

Vous pouvez consulter les articles, les modifier si nécessaire, choisir le blog sur lequel ils sont publiés et ajuster les visuels ou les catégories.

Étape 10 : Connecter Google Search Console

Pour suivre l'impact des articles générés par Oscar, connectez la Google Search Console.

1

Vérifiez votre site dans Google Search Console

Assurez-vous que votre domaine Shopify (votre nom de domaine public, ex: votreboutique.com) est bien enregistré dans Google Search Console avec des données visibles.

2

Connectez Google à Oscar

Dans Oscar, allez dans l'onglet « Intégration » et cliquez sur « Se connecter avec Google ».

Bouton de connexion Google

Bouton de connexion Google

3

Autorisez l'accès

Sélectionnez le compte Google qui gère votre Search Console.

Message de validation

Si Google affiche un message indiquant que l'application est en cours de validation, cliquez sur « Paramètres avancés », puis confirmez.
4

Consultez vos performances

Une fois connecté, allez dans l'onglet « Analyse » d'Oscar pour voir :

  • Les impressions
  • Les clics
  • Les requêtes tapées par vos visiteurs
  • Les pages qui génèrent le plus de trafic

Récapitulatif

Les étapes en résumé :

  1. Récupérer le nom de la boutique dans l'URL Shopify (/store/…)
  2. Aller dans Paramètres → Applications → Développer des applications → Dev dashboard
  3. Créer une application avec l'App URL https://www.app.oscar-seo.ai
  4. Configurer les scopes : read_content, write_content, read_files, write_files
  5. Ajouter l'URL de redirection vers Oscar
  6. Récupérer le Client ID et le Client Secret
  7. Se connecter à Oscar (même navigateur) et configurer l'entreprise
  8. Dans le provider Shopify, saisir le nom de boutique, Client ID et Client Secret
  9. Installer l'application côté Shopify
  10. Nommer son Oscar et choisir le mode de publication
  11. Les articles apparaissent dans Contenu → Articles de blog
  12. Connecter Google Search Console pour le suivi

Besoin d'aide ?

Si vous bloquez à une étape, n'hésitez pas à contacter l'équipe support Oscar depuis votre espace.Contactez-nous.